Octopus Systems returns as Main Sponsor for TechEng 2026
TechEng Expo has announced that Octopus Systems will return as the Main Sponsor for TechEng 2026, reaffirming its commitment to advancing engineering and technology solutions within the hospitality sector.
Following its role as Main Sponsor during the inaugural edition, the continued partnership with Octopus Systems reflects strong alignment with TechEng Expo’s vision of creating a dedicated platform for systems, infrastructure, and technologies that power modern hospitality.
As a leading provider of integrated engineering and technology solutions, Octopus Systems has established a strong presence in the Maldives, supporting resorts and hospitality developments with specialised expertise across the full spectrum of ELV systems. Its involvement in TechEng Expo underscores the growing importance of reliable, efficient, and future-ready infrastructure in the region’s tourism industry.
Positioned as a specialised B2B platform, TechEng Expo brings together solution providers and industry stakeholders across ten core sectors, including power generation and distribution, water and wastewater systems, mechanical systems, ELV and ICT infrastructure, transport and logistics, hospitality software and applications, and auxiliary services.
Building on the momentum of its debut, TechEng 2026, scheduled to take place from 6–8 October 2026 at Central Park, Hulhumalé, will continue to serve as a focused marketplace where engineering and operations converge. The event connects solution providers with a targeted audience of resort operators, developers, technical consultants, and public and private sector decision-makers.
The first edition of TechEng Expo attracted over 500 industry attendees and 30+ exhibiting brands, with a strong presence of decision-makers and technical stakeholders – highlighting the demand for a platform dedicated to engineering and technology within hospitality.
